Q: Is 693,704 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 693,704 is a composite number.

Why is 693,704 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 693,704 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 8 11 22 44 88 7,883 15,766 31,532 63,064 86,713 173,426 346,852 and 693,704, with no remainder.

Since 693,704 cannot be divided by just 1 and 693,704, it is a composite number.
